Regulation and License Check
Regulation Ease
44/100
An Airbnb business in Kissimmee needs local verification around lodging tax, hoa or lease restrictions, and real estate licensing. Confirm state, city, county, tax, zoning, insurance, and industry-specific requirements before launch.
License Risk
Lower verification risk
Airbnb Business has lower verification risk in the BizScoutIQ license check model. Use official sources to confirm what applies in Kissimmee before advertising, signing leases, buying major equipment, or accepting customers.
What to verify
- - Florida Division of Corporations registration or entity filing rules
- - Florida Department of Revenue accounts if sales tax, employer tax, or other tax registrations apply
- - Kissimmee and county business license, zoning, signage, location, or home-occupation rules
- - real estate-specific licensing, insurance, inspections, or professional restrictions
- - Check sales tax treatment for the exact operating model.
- - Confirm hoa or lease restrictions with official or qualified sources.

Questions to Validate Before Launch
These questions help turn the idea into a testable launch plan.
- Are short-term rentals allowed locally?
- Can occupancy support costs?
- Who handles cleaning and maintenance?
- What taxes or registration apply?
- How active is the local rental or sales market?
- What licensing rules apply?
- Which property owners are underserved?
